Miami bound

27 November 2010 | Miami Beach
Howard/ sunny,warm
Pulled anchor at 0730 hrs and went to Lauderdale Marina for a pump out ($15.00), diesel fuel ($3.71 per gallon) some gas ($4.56 per gallon) and we topped up the water tanks and got rid of the garbage for free so that was a plus, a bit excessive in price but that is what it is like at marinas, they have a captured audience and can pretty well charge as they please. We went outside again in order to miss some more bridges, wind was on the nose but we made good time and had the anchor down again at 1345 hrs, we anchored just off the Venetian Causeway at Miami Beach, a good place to do last minute provisioning as there is a Publix a short dinghy ride down a canal. We will probably stay here a few days before making a move to No Name Harbor or else straight on to the Bahamas depending on what the weather is doing.
